Originally posted by Roberto Baggio Roberto Baggio wrote:

According to the BBC news last night the death rate in Iran is 20% for people who contract the virus
 
Yeah they have had something like 95 cases and 16 deaths. A read an interesting opinion on the bbc website about how the viruses spread and that what will often happen is that in places with peaceful societies and good healthcare services viruses cause a lot less damage. One of the reasons is that those who are very ill tend to remain at home. And that those with mild cases will just go on about life meaning the mild strain becomes the strain that passes from person to person. In war ravaged countries or countries experiencing turmoil those experiencing the deadlier strain end up in hospitals or field hospitals whilst those experiencing the mild strain stay were they are. Obviously then healthcare is huge as the more prepared the system is the better the survival rates. China was hit with this very quickly and it is difficult to contain. The rest of the world is aware of the virus and put all protocols and other preventative measures in place hopefully limiting the virus ability. It was a good article, must see if I can find it.
